I'm using asterisk 1.6.2.11 with realtime SIP (mysql DB).

I notice that when the SIP peer registers, the fields 'fullcontact', 'ipaddr', 'port', 'regserver', 'regseconds', 'lastms' are filled with values.

But after a while, these fields become empty.

Asterisk CLI shows :

asterisk*CLI> sip show peers
Name/username Host Dyn Nat ACL Port Status Realtime
sterk1/sterk1  192.168.1.102    D   N      5062     OK (30 ms) Cached RT
test13/test13      192.168.1.100    D   N      5060     OK (4 ms)  Cached RT
test2/test2        192.168.1.102    D   N      5061     OK (30 ms) Cached RT
test6/test6        192.168.1.104    D   N      5063     OK (12 ms) Cached RT


So Asterisk is still aware of the realtime SIP peers, and they are still reachable and working (IP-phones).

But why do the fields in the mysql DB become empty ?!

Is this a bug ?! (in asterisk 1.4.30 the fields remain filled until unregister)
